Output 12448499a26cfe7974ebbeef07a7df7e4293d1945a59744c2b720632a7958adb:0

value
2581475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7757a59693563859353259f2aab30432bf28a90a OP_EQUAL
address
3Ca3LBPnZ9HP7KzArnrvEJgPo5shMf5wU4
transaction
12448499a26cfe7974ebbeef07a7df7e4293d1945a59744c2b720632a7958adb
spent
true